@font-face {
    font-family: 'bebasregular';
    src: url('../fonts/BEBAS___-webfont.eot');
    src: url('../fonts/BEBAS___-webfont.eot?#iefix') format('embedded-opentype'),
         url('../fonts/BEBAS___-webfont.woff') format('woff'),
         url('../fonts/BEBAS___-webfont.ttf') format('truetype'),
         url('../fonts/BEBAS___-webfont.svg#bebasregular') format('svg');
    font-weight: normal;
    font-style: normal;
}

/*Body */
body {
width:960px;
height:auto;
background-color: rgb(255, 255, 255);
margin-right:auto;
margin-left:auto;
margin-bottom:0px;
margin-top:0px;
}

/*Banners */
div#banner1 {
position: relative;
float: left;
margin-top: 30px;
}
div#banner1 img{
width: 180px;  
}

div#banner2 {
position: relative;
float: left;
margin-top: 30px;
margin-left: 1%;
}

div#banner2 img{
position: relative;
width: 770px;

}

/*Menu de cabecera*/
.top_menu ul {
position: relative;
margin-top: -9%;
right: -18%;
list-style:none;
float:left;
padding: 2%;
width:95%;
font-family: sans-serif;
text-align: center;
}

.top_menu ul li{
float:left;
width: 158px;
margin-right:5px;
margin-bottom:10px;
background:rgb(255, 7, 131);
padding:15px;
text-align: center;
}

.top_menu ul li a{
color: rgb(255, 255, 255);
text-decoration:none;
}

li#catedrade  {
background-color: rgb(235, 74, 161);
}

li#catedrade:hover {
background-color: rgb(226, 117, 176);
}

li#propuestade  {
background-color: rgb(73, 171, 195);
}

li#propuestade:hover {
background-color: rgb(114, 181, 198);
}

li#programade  {
background-color: rgb(225, 212, 134);
}

li#programade:hover {
background-color: rgb(222, 216, 177);
}

li#equipode  {
background-color: rgb(73, 73, 73);
}

li#equipode:hover {
background-color: rgb(103, 103, 103);
}



/*Mas Noticias - Titulo */
div#masnoticias h1{
margin:17px;
width: 12%;
height: 12%;
font-family: "bebasregular", sans-serif;
font-size: 20px;
top: 200px;
position: left;
right:-32px;

color: rgb(119, 119, 119);
}






div#noticias2{
margin:16px;
background: rgb(238, 238, 238);
padding:6px;
text-align: center;
font-family: sans-serif;
font-size: 9px;
border: 3px solid rgb(200, 200, 200);
color: rgb(0, 0, 0);
text-align: left;
position: relative;
margin-top: 8%;
right: 1%;
list-style:none;
float:left;
width:16%;
}



div#noticias3 {
margin:16px;
background: rgb(238, 238, 238);
padding:6px;
text-align: center;
font-family: sans-serif;
font-size: 9px;
border: 3px solid rgb(200, 200, 200);
color: rgb(0, 0, 0);
text-align: left;
position: relative;
margin-top: 50%;
right: 1%;
list-style:none;

width:16%;
}


.vermasmenu ul li{
position: relative;
top: -186px;
left: 44px;
margin: 16px;
margin-bottom: 13.4%;
list-style:none;
font-family: "bebasregular", sans-serif;
font-size: 15px;
}

.vermasmenu ul li a{
text-decoration: none;
color: rgb(0, 158, 239);
}

.vermasmenu a:hover {
color: rgb(91, 189, 239);
}





/*Nota */
div#noticias_nota h1{
font-family: "bebasregular", sans-serif;
font-size: 32px;
right:-200px;
color:rgb(14, 119, 77);
 position: relative; 
 top:-725px; 
}

div#noticias_nota h2{
font-family: sans-serif;
font-size: 20px;
right:-200px;
color:rgb(0, 0, 0);
 position: relative; 
 top:-723px; 
}

div#noticias_nota p{
font-family: sans-serif;
font-size: 12px;
right:-200px;
color:rgb(0, 0, 0);
 position: relative; 
 top:-733px;  
    width: 540px;
}
div#nota2{
background: rgba(14, 119, 77, 0.4);
padding:6px;
right:-190px;
    top:-650px; 
    position:relative;
    width: 560px;
    height: 130px;
}


div#nota{
background: rgba(14, 119, 77, 0.4);
padding:6px;

right:-190px;
    top:-670px; 
    position:relative;
    width: 560px;
}


div#nota h2{
    font-family: sans-serif;
font-size: 17px;
right:-260px;
color:rgb(0, 0, 0);
 position: relative; 
 top:-14px; 
    width: 200px;
}
div#imagen1 {
float:left;
position: relative;
right:-200px;
top:-810px;
}
div#imagen1 img{
width: 250px;  
    
}
div#imagen2 {
float:left;
position: relative;
right:-200px;
top:-788px;
}
div#imagen2 img{
width: 250px;  
    
}

div#logofaduverde {
    float:right;
position: relative;
right:30px;
top:-940px;
}
div#logofaduverde img{
width: 160px;  
    
}

div#nota p{
    font-family: sans-serif;
font-size: 12px;
right:-260px;
color:rgb(0, 0, 0);
 position: relative; 
 top:-20px;  
 width: 300px;
}

div#nota2 h2{
    font-family: sans-serif;
font-size: 17px;
right:-260px;
color:rgb(0, 0, 0);
 position: relative; 
 top:-120px; 
    width: 200px;
}

div#nota2 p{
    font-family: sans-serif;
font-size: 12px;
right:-260px;
color:rgb(0, 0, 0);
 position: relative; 
 top:-130px;  
    width: 300px;
}













/*Menu de lateral */
.left_menu ul {
position: relative;
margin-top: 8%;
right: 1%;
list-style:none;
float:left;
padding: 2%;
width:95%;
font-family: sans-serif;
text-align: center;
}

.left_menu ul li{
width: 140px;
margin-right:5px;
margin-bottom:10px;
background: rgb(238, 238, 238);
padding:10px;
text-align: center;
}

.left_menu ul li:hover{
background-color: rgb(152, 152, 152);
}

.left_menu ul li a{
color: rgb(0, 0, 0);
text-decoration:none;
}

.left_menu ul li a:hover{
color: rgb(255, 255, 255);
}

div#catedra h1{
font-family: "bebasregular", sans-serif;
font-size: 32px;
right:-200px;
color:rgb(235, 74, 161);
position: relative; 
top:-330px; 

}

div#catedra p{
font-family: sans-serif;
font-size: 12px;
right:-200px;
color:rgb(0, 0, 0);
 position: relative; 
 top:-340px;  
    width: 350px;
}

div#catedra p1{
font-family: sans-serif;
font-size: 12px;
right:10px;
color:rgb(0, 0, 0);
 position: relative; 
    float:right;
 top:-834px;  
    width: 350px;
}
/*Alumnos - Titulo */
div#alumnos h1{
width: 12%;
height: 12%;
font-family: "bebasregular", sans-serif;
font-size: 26px;
position: relative;
right:-32px;
top: -275px;
color: rgb(119, 119, 119);
}
















/*Botonera correo */
div#correo_logo2 img{
position: relative;
right: -6px;
top: 200px;
width: 32px;
}

/*Correo*/
#correo nav ul {
position: relative;
width: 160px;
margin:-100;
left: -200px;
top: -390px;
padding:0;
list-style:none;
}

#correo nav ul li a {
text-decoration:none;
font-family: sans-serif;
font-size:16px;
color:rgb(0, 0, 0);
}

#correo a:hover {
color:rgb(144, 144, 144);
}

/*Footer - Mapa de Navegación y Derechos de autor*/
#footer {
position: relative;
height:93px;
top: -500px;
clear:both;
background-color:rgb(128, 128, 128);
margin-top:20px;
}

footer nav { 
width:620px;
height:96px;
}

footer nav ul { 
position: relative;
margin:-150;
left: 166px;
padding:0;
list-style:none;
}

footer nav ul li { 
float:left;
margin-right:2px;
}

footer nav ul li a {
text-decoration:none;
height:30px;
padding-left:10px;
padding-right:10px;
line-height:50px;
display:block;
font-family: sans-serif;
font-size:12px;
color:rgb(255, 255, 255);
}

#footer a:hover {
color:rgb(191, 191, 191);
}

.derechos {
position: relative;
float:left;
top: -500px;
width:760px;
height:90px;
clear:both;
color:rgb(0, 0, 0);
font-family:'Rosario', sans-serif;
font-size:12px;
background-color:rgb(238, 238, 238);
padding-left:100px;
padding-right:100px;
padding-top:10px;
text-align:center;
}

/*Botonera de Redes Sociales */
div#redes_sociales img{
position: relative;
top: 160px;
left: 73%;
width: 5%
}













